When visiting Hartwood, it’s essential to know that the station operates without a ticket office or ticket machines. Thus, it is advisable to purchase your tickets online ahead of time. There are no smartcard issuing facilities but validators are present, ensuring a straightforward start to your journey. The station also offers an induction loop service to assist those with hearing impairments.
While the station lacks staff assistance, a help point is available for general inquiries. Departure screens and announcements provide essential information for your journey. For those concerned about safety and security, rest assured that CCTV surveillance is operational. It's worth highlighting that, although step-free access is available to parts of the station, caution is advised due to the pronounced stepping distance onto the trains.
Your journey doesn't stop at the train—Hartwood has established connections with other transportation modes for seamless travel. For those requiring bus services, Hartwood Road serves as a pick-up and drop-off point for rail replacement services, easily found through this location link. In addition, Traveline Scotland provides comprehensive information on local bus services for those keen on exploring the public transport system.
Taxi services can be sourced from Train Taxi, providing reliable options for onward travel. For cyclists, the station offers stands for bicycle storage, although these areas are not sheltered and lack CCTV coverage. Please be aware that there are no bicycle hire facilities on-site.

Blackpool North Train Station boasts a comprehensive range of facilities to cater to the needs of travelers. The ticket office operates with varying hours throughout the week, providing flexibility for commuters. For those who prefer self-service, ticket machines are strategically placed within the station, including accessible options for those with mobility needs. Smartcards available at the station further enhance the convenience of travel.
The station is categorized as a Category A station, offering step-free access throughout. This makes it particularly scooter-friendly, with multiple ramps and step-free routes available from various entry points. Enhanced accessibility features, such as induction loops and accessible toilets, ensure that navigating the station is straightforward for all passengers.
